The Airbus A330 is a cornerstone of long-haul aviation, known for its efficiency and comfort. With four major variants in its family, airlines have tailored their cabins to provide unique experiences for passengers packing their luggage for travelling on Spring holidays as the weather gets warmer once again. Let’s take a closer look at some airlines that stand out for their exceptional A330 cabins.”

Virgin Atlantic’s A330neo

Virgin Atlantic's A330neo
Virgin Atlantic’s A330neo

Virgin Atlantic made waves in 2019 when it became the first UK airline to order the A330neo. This new addition to their fleet features the Retreat Suite, a luxurious cabin upgrade that epitomizes comfort and style. With only 262 seats spread across four classes, including Economy Light, Economy Delight, Premium, and Upper Class, Virgin Atlantic ensures a spacious and exclusive environment for its passengers.

The Upper-Class cabin boasts fully flat beds up to 6 feet 7 inches long, providing a restful journey for passengers. The airline’s focus on premium seating and personalized service sets it apart, making it a top choice for travellers seeking a luxurious flying experience.

Delta Air Lines’ A330neo

Delta Air Lines' A330neo
Delta Air Lines’ A330neo

Delta Air Lines, the largest operator of the A330-900 globally, also offers a convenient and comfortable cabin configuration for the A330neo. With four major cabin classes, including economy, economy plus, economy premium, and business class, Delta provides a range of options to suit passengers’ preferences.

Delta Air Lines' A330neo
Delta Air Lines’ A330neo

The Delta One Suites, featuring fully flat beds up to 80 inches long, offer a luxurious way to travel long distances. With a focus on customer satisfaction, Delta Air Lines continues to be a leading choice for travellers around the world.

Kuwait Airways’ A330-800

Kuwait Airways' A330-800
Kuwait Airways’ A330-800

Kuwait Airways has embraced the A330-800 variant, offering a comfortable and spacious cabin configuration for its passengers. With two classes, including economy and business class, Kuwait Airways provides a relaxed and enjoyable travel experience.

The business class seats, with a seat pitch of up to 78 inches, ensure ample legroom for passengers to stretch out and relax. Kuwait Airways’ commitment to passenger satisfaction makes it a preferred choice for travellers flying the A330-800.

SWISS’ A330-300

SWISS' A330-300
SWISS’ A330-300

SWISS stands out for its exceptional cabin configuration on the A330-300, offering a luxurious and comfortable travel experience. With first-class service available, SWISS provides passengers with the ultimate in comfort and style.

The first-class cabin features seats with a seat pitch of up to 83 inches, providing passengers with ample space to relax and unwind. SWISS’ dedication to passenger comfort and satisfaction makes it a top choice for travellers seeking a luxurious flying experience.

In conclusion, the Airbus A330 offers airlines a versatile platform to create unique and comfortable cabins for their passengers. Whether it’s Virgin Atlantic’s luxurious Retreat Suite or SWISS’ first-class service, these airlines exemplify the best in A330 cabin design, providing passengers with an exceptional flying experience.
